A000144 Number of ways of writing n as a sum of 10 squares. +0
2
1, 20, 180, 960, 3380, 8424, 16320, 28800, 52020, 88660, 129064, 175680, 262080, 386920, 489600, 600960, 840500, 1137960, 1330420, 1563840, 2050344, 2611200, 2986560, 3358080, 4194240, 5318268, 5878440, 6299520, 7862400, 9619560 (list; graph; listen)
OFFSET

0,2

REFERENCES

E. Grosswald, Representations of Integers as Sums of Squares. Springer-Verlag, NY, 1985, p. 121.

G. H. Hardy and E. M. Wright, An Introduction to the Theory of Numbers. 3rd ed., Oxford Univ. Press, 1954, p. 314.

G. H. Hardy, Ramanujan: twelve lectures on subjects suggested by his life and work, Chelsea Publishing Company, New York 1959, p. 135 section 9.3. MR0106147 (21 #4881)

LINKS

T. D. Noe, Table of n, a(n) for n=0..10000

H. H. Chan and C. Krattenthaler, Recent progress in the study of representations of integers as sums of squares

Index entries for sequences related to sums of squares

FORMULA

Euler transform of period 4 sequence [20, -30, 20, -10, ...]. - Michael Somos Sep 12 2005

Expansion of eta(q^2)^50/(eta(q)eta(q^4))^20 in powers of q. - Michael Somos Sep 12 2005

a(n)=4/5*(A050456(n)+16*A050468(n)+8*A030212(n)) if n>0. - Michael Somos Sepe 12 2005

MAPLE

(sum(x^(m^2), m=-10..10))^10;

MATHEMATICA

Needs["NumberTheory`NumberTheoryFunctions`"]; Table[SumOfSquaresR[10, n], {n, 0, 30}] (*Chandler*)

PROGRAM

(PARI) a(n)=if(n<0, 0, polcoeff(sum(k=1, sqrtint(n), 2*x^k^2, 1+x*O(x^n))^10, n)) /* Michael Somos Sep 12 2005 */
